Diary of 
Captain W. W. Old, A. D. C. 
Kept from June 13, 1864 to August 12th, 1864

The operations of Lieut. General Jubal A. Early 
in the Valley of Virginia and Maryland. 

June 13th, Monday. 

Left the trenches around Richmond, with corps 
complosed of Gordon's Division, Maj. Gen Jno. B. Gordon, 
commanding: Rodes' Division, Maj. Gen. Robert E. Rodes, 
commanding, Earley's Division, Maj. Gen. S, D. Ramseur, com-
manding, and Wilson's and Braxton's Battallions of Artillery, 
Brig. Gen. A. L. Long, commanding.  Marched to Goddall's Tavern.
